A portable switch cabinet door limiter
By designing the support and telescopic components of the portable switch cabinet door limiter, the problem of the switch cabinet door accidentally closing due to external forces during operation and maintenance was solved, thereby improving safety and ease of operation.

AI Technical Summary
In existing technologies, switch cabinet doors may be accidentally closed due to external forces during operation and maintenance, affecting the operational convenience and personal safety of maintenance personnel, and reducing work efficiency.
A portable switch cabinet door limiter was designed, comprising a support assembly and a telescopic assembly. The support assembly supports the cabinet door through a structure including a central block, a support rod, a rotating ring, and a limit gear. The telescopic assembly adjusts its length through a telescopic rod and a positioning component to accommodate different opening and closing angles, preventing the cabinet door from closing accidentally.
It effectively supports the cabinet door, prevents accidental closure, improves operational convenience and safety, adapts to different opening and closing angles, and enhances work efficiency.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of cabinet door limiters, and particularly relates to a portable switch cabinet door limiter.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the process of power facility operation and maintenance, the switch cabinet door is usually not fixed, and the moving switch cabinet door can contact the staff in front of the cabinet door at any time, which can cause safety risks. The fixed opening and closing angle of the switch cabinet door has a direct impact on the safety and work efficiency of equipment maintenance operation. In the prior art, the cabinet door is usually directly opened to the maximum. However, even if the cabinet door is opened to the maximum, it can be affected by external forces during operation and maintenance, which can cause the cabinet door to be closed accidentally. This not only affects the operation convenience and personal safety of the on-site maintenance personnel, but also affects the work efficiency. SUMMARY

[0029] Embodiment 1
[0030] Reference Figures 1-3 For the first embodiment of the present application, the embodiment provides a portable switch cabinet door stopper, the portable switch cabinet door stopper includes a support assembly 100 and a telescopic assembly 200, the support assembly 100 can support and limit the cabinet door when it is opened, and at the same time, the support length can be freely adjusted through the telescopic assembly 200, so that it is suitable for cabinet doors with different opening angles.
[0031] Specifically, the support assembly 100 comprises a center block 101, a first support rod 102, a rotating ring 103, a second support rod 104, a suction accessory 105, a limiting gear 106, a pressing rod 107, a tooth ring 108 and a limiting piece 109, the first support rod 102 is fixed on one side of the center block 101, the rotating ring 103 is rotatably connected to the top of the center block 101, the second support rod 104 is fixed on one side of the rotating ring 103, the suction accessory 105 is arranged at the end of the first support rod 102 and the second support rod 104, the limiting gear 106 is fixed at the bottom of the rotating ring 103, the first cavity S1 is arranged in the center block 101, the pressing rod 107 slides in the first cavity S1, the tooth ring 108 is fixed at the bottom end of the pressing rod 107 and cooperates with the limiting gear 106, and the limiting piece 109 is arranged on the pressing rod 107.
[0032] The center block 101 and the rotating ring 103 are both circular, and are rotatably connected through a bearing, when the rotating ring 103 rotates on the center block 101, the included angle between the first support rod 102 and the second support rod 104 can be adjusted, so that the stopper can be applied to cabinet doors with different opening angles, the suction accessory 105 is provided with two, which are rotatably connected at the ends of the two support rods through hinges or fixed shafts, so that they can adapt to different installation angles when supporting, one is fixed on the cabinet door, and the other can be fixed on the cabinet body or other positions that can provide stable support.
[0033] The limiting gear 106 and the tooth ring 108 can fix the rotating ring 103 when they are engaged, so that the rotating ring 103 cannot rotate relative to the center block 101, and the two can rotate when they are separated, when the pressing rod 107 moves into the first cavity S1, the tooth ring 108 can be driven away from the limiting gear 106, and the limiting piece 109 limits the pressing rod 107 and the tooth ring 108, so that they are more convenient to use.
[0034] The telescopic assembly 200 is arranged in the first support rod 102 and comprises a telescopic rod 201, a positioning piece 202 and a limiting piece 203, the telescopic rod 201 slides in the first support rod 102, the positioning piece 202 is arranged between the first support rod 102 and the telescopic rod 201, and the limiting piece 203 is arranged in the first support rod 102.
[0035] The telescopic rod 201 can extend the support length of the first support rod 102, so that the range of use of the stopper is larger, the positioning piece 202 is used for limiting and fixing the telescopic rod 201, so that the telescopic rod 201 can be stably fixed at any length, and the limiting piece 203 cooperates with the tooth ring 108 and the limiting piece 109, so that the stopper is more convenient to store.
[0036] Embodiment 2
[0037] Reference Figures 1-8 This is the second embodiment of the application, which is based on the previous embodiment.
[0038] Specifically, the limiting piece 109 comprises a cross column 109a, a top plate 109b and a first spring 109c, the cross column 109a is fixed in the first cavity S1, the pressing rod 107 is provided with a cross groove K matched with the cross column 109a, the top plate 109b is fixed at the top end of the pressing rod 107, and the first spring 109c is fixed at the bottom of the top plate 109b and in contact with the rotating ring 103 at the bottom end.
[0039] The cross column 109a slides in the cross groove K to limit the pressing rod 107, avoiding rotation of the pressing rod 107 during upward and downward movement, the top plate 109b is arranged to facilitate the user to press the pressing rod 107 downward, and the first spring 109c applies an upward thrust to the top plate 109b and the pressing rod 107, so that the worker can reset faster after releasing the top plate 109b, thereby driving the gear ring 108 to engage with the limiting gear 106 to fix the rotating ring 103.
[0040] The limiting piece 109 further comprises a movable block 109d, a connecting rod 109e, a limiting block 109f and a fixed block 109g, the movable block 109d is rotatably connected to the middle part of the top plate 109b, the connecting rod 109e is fixed to the bottom of the movable block 109d, the limiting block 109f is fixed to the bottom end of the connecting rod 109e, and the fixed block 109g is fixed to the inner wall of the cross groove K and matched with the limiting block 109f.
[0041] The movable block 109d is rotatably connected to the middle part of the top plate 109b through a bearing, the fixed block 109g is provided with two fixed blocks 109g, which are symmetrically distributed on the inner wall of the cross groove K, when the worker presses the top plate 109b downward, the limiting block 109f will move below the fixed block 109g, at this time, the worker can manually twist the movable block 109d to rotate the limiting block 109f to contact the bottom of the fixed block 109g, thereby limiting the pressing rod 107 and the gear ring 108, so that they cannot be reset by the first spring 109c, at this time, the rotating ring 103 can be rotated at will, and the worker can rotate the second supporting rod 104 to be attached to the first supporting rod 102, thereby facilitating the storage of the limiting piece after use.
[0042] The limiting piece 109 further comprises a convex block 109h fixed to one side of the movable block 109d, and an arc-shaped groove P is formed in the top plate 109b matched with the convex block 109h.
[0043] The arc-shaped groove P is ninety degrees, and the convex block 109h slides in the arc-shaped groove P to limit the movable block 109d, so that when the movable block 109d is rotated to the two ends, it corresponds to the fixed and unfixed states respectively, avoiding excessive rotation angle when fixing is needed.
[0044] The top of the movable block 109d is fixed with a rectangular strip 109d-1 which is protruding to facilitate the rotation of the movable block 109d while the pressing rod 107 is being pressed down.
[0045] Embodiment 3
[0046] With reference to Figures 1-8 Figures 1-8 For the third embodiment of the present application, the embodiment is based on the first two embodiments.
[0047] Specifically, the positioning member 202 comprises a movable rod 202a, a connecting plate 202b, positioning rods 202c, a pressing plate 203d and a second spring 202e. The movable rod 202a is sliding on the first supporting rod 102. The connecting plate 202b is fixed to the bottom end of the movable rod 202a. The positioning rods 202c are fixed to the top of the connecting plate 202b on both sides. The middle part of the telescopic rod 201 is provided with a rectangular slot Y. The bottom part is provided with a positioning slot M which cooperates with the positioning rods 202c. The pressing plate 203d is fixed to the top end of the movable rod 202a. The second spring 202e is fixed to the bottom part of the pressing plate 203d and its bottom end is in contact with the first supporting rod 102.
[0048] A plurality of positioning slots M are provided on both sides of the inner top wall of the rectangular slot Y. The second spring 202e applies an upward thrust to the pressing plate 203d and the movable rod 202a, so that the two positioning rods 202c are inserted into the positioning slots M on both sides. At this time, the telescopic rod 201 can be fixed and cannot be telescoped. When the length needs to be adjusted, the pressing plate 203d can be pressed down so that the positioning rods 202c are separated from the positioning slots M. The length of the telescopic rod 201 can be manually adjusted freely.
[0049] The positioning member 202 further comprises a stop block 202f which is fixed to the end of the rectangular slot Y. The top of the stop block 202f is provided with a groove. When the telescopic rod 201 needs to be removed, the pressing plate 203d is first pressed down so that the positioning rods 202c are separated from the positioning slots M. Then the pressing plate 203d is manually rotated so that the connecting plate 202b is parallel to the rectangular slot Y. At this time, the pressing plate 203d is loosened and the pressing plate 203d and the movable rod 202a are pushed upward by the second spring 202e. Two through holes are provided on the first supporting rod 102. At this time, the positioning rods 202c are located in the two through holes. The telescopic rod 201 can be pulled out. The connecting plate 202b is separated from the groove. The telescopic rod 201 can be removed.
[0050] The limiting piece 203 comprises a limiting block 203a, a top rod 203b and a fixing rod 203c, the inner wall of the first chamber S1 is provided with a through hole L, the limiting block 203a slides in the through hole L, the top rod 203b is fixed to the bottom of one side of the limiting block 203a and cooperates with the limiting block 109f, and the fixing rod 203c is fixed to one side of the limiting block 203a and located in the first supporting rod 102.
[0051] The fixing rod 203c is L-shaped and located in the first supporting rod 102, the top rod 203b is located in the cross column 109a in the initial state and parallel to the limiting block 109f, when the limiting block 109f is in the position of contacting the bottom of the fixing block 109g, the top rod 203b is pushed to the direction of the limiting block 109f, so that the limiting block 109f is pushed and rotated by the top rod 203b to be separated from the fixing block 109g.
[0052] The limiting block 203a is located in the through hole L in the initial state and below the tooth ring 108, when it is needed to store the limiting piece, the top plate 109b is pressed downward by the worker, the limiting block 109f is moved below the fixing block 109g, at this time, the worker manually twists the movable block 109d to rotate the limiting block 109f to contact the bottom of the fixing block 109g, so that the pressing rod 107 and the tooth ring 108 are limited and cannot be pushed to reset by the first spring 109c, at this time, the rotating ring 103 can be rotated at will, the worker can rotate the second supporting rod 104 to be attached to the first supporting rod 102, and the telescopic rod 201 is completely inserted into the first supporting rod 102, the fixing rod 203c and the limiting block 203a are moved by the telescopic rod 201, and the top rod 203b is moved to the direction of the limiting block 109f, the limiting block 109f is rotated by the top rod 203b to be separated from the fixing block 109g, at this time, the first spring 109c applies an upward pushing force to the top plate 109b and the pressing rod 107 to make them reset quickly, so as to drive the tooth ring 108 to engage with the limiting gear 106 to fix the rotating ring 103, so that the two supporting rods are fixed, and the limiting block 203a is partially located in the first chamber S1 and below the tooth ring 108, the tooth ring 108 is limited by the limiting block 203a to avoid the tooth ring 108 from being separated from the limiting gear 106 accidentally during storage and transportation, so that the two supporting rods are separated.
[0053] The limiting piece 203 further comprises a baffle 203d and a third spring 203e, the baffle 203d is fixed in the through hole L, and the third spring 203e is fixed at both ends of the fixing rod 203c and the baffle 203d.
[0054] The baffle 203d is used to limit the limiting block 203a, so that the limiting block 203a can be located in the through hole L in the initial state, and the third spring 203e is used to apply a force to the fixed rod 203c and the limiting block 203a to move to the inside of the first supporting rod 102, so that the telescopic rod 201 can be reset more quickly when it is extended from the inside of the first supporting rod 102.
[0055] The material of the suction accessory 105 is a magnet, which can be more convenient and stable to fix on the cabinet door and the cabinet body. This part can also be provided with a suction cup or the like, and a person skilled in the art can set it as required.
